"Reconnecting with Former Church Members" by Olan Thomas & Yves Monnier

"Reconnecting with Former Church Members" by Olan Thomas and Yves Monnier [HQ]

Sometimes people slip out the back door of the church. The reasons vary: a bad experience with a pastor or a member, or perhaps life and other activities started to fill their time. Should we approach former church members with invitations for Bible studies? Church events? If so, how?
